This training course equips you with the knowledge and skills to design, implement, and manage effective national qualifications databases. Following the European Interoperability Framework, the course explores four key dimensions in developing interoperable qualifications databases:
- Regulatory: Legal foundations and trust in qualification data
- Organisational: Governance, quality assurance, and structured processes
- Semantic: Ensuring data clarity and consistency using the European Learning Model
- Technical: Core functionalities like data verification, publication, and export
